Fed cuts won’t impact Westport schools

Westport schools will lose about $85,000 under a federal education funding freeze, but the impact will be minimal compared to high-needs districts like Bridgeport, which could lose $3.8 million. Statewide, $53.6 million is at risk as Connecticut joins 25 other states in suing the Trump administration over the cuts.
